 6.5.3 'mktex' script arguments
 ------------------------------
 
 The first argument to a 'mktex' script is always the name of the file to
 be created.
 
    In the default 'mktexpk' implementation, additional arguments may
 also be passed:
 
 '--dpi NUM'
      Sets the resolution of the generated font to NUM.
 '--mfmode NAME'
      Sets the Metafont mode to NAME.
 '--bdpi NUM'
      Sets the "base dpi" for the font.  This must match the mode being
      used.
 '--mag STRING'
      A "magstep" string suitable for the Metafont 'mag' variable.  This
      must match the combination of BDPI and DPI being used.
 '--destdir STRING'
      A directory name.  If the directory is absolute, it is used as-is.
      Otherwise, it is appended to the root destination directory set in
      the script.
